Heather Lewis, Registered Dental Hygienist
Heather was born in Goldsboro, North Carolina and then moved to Mount Olive in middle school. She graduated from Southern Wayne High School in 2008 prior to beginning her dental hygiene. She attended the dental hygiene program at Wayne Community College where she graduated in 2011 and began her career as a Registered Dental Hygienist. Heather began working at Mitchell Family Dentistry in 2020 with 10 years of hygiene experience under her belt. Admirably, she has volunteered on Fridays and weekends to help with giving dental treatment to members of the Army Reserve, which is indicative of her giving spirit and selfless heart.
Heather has three beautiful nieces that keep her very busy and entertained. Not to be overshadowed, her two spoiled puppies, Titan and Cooper, command a lot of her attention, too. In her free time, Heather enjoys spending quality time with family and friends. Her favorite place to be is in the sunshine at the beach! Heather’s favorite part about being a Dental Hygienist is meeting and getting to know all of her wonderful patients!
Lynn Whaley, Registered Dental Hygienist, OSHA Officer
Lynn knew she wanted to be a dental hygienist at the age of sixteen. However, she recalls she had to make a few thousand biscuits before that would happen! Lynn worked at her family’s restaurant, Byrd’s Takeout and Catering, for eight years before attending college. Lynn completed the Dental Hygiene program at Wayne Community College from which she graduated from in 1992. She earned the Academic Achievement Award for her graduating class. Lynn found her “dental home” in 1996 at Mitchell Family Dentistry when she began working with Dr. Courtney Mitchell III.
Lynn has supported the profession of dental hygiene at both the local and state level. She has been a delegate for the North Carolina Dental Hygiene Association (NCDHA) at the House of Delegates meetings. At the local level, she has served the Southeastern Dental Hygiene Component as a Trustee, Secretary, and Treasurer. Lynn currently serves on the NCDHA as a Trustee for District Four.
Lynn is married to Joey Whaley and they have a daughter, Lindsay. Her greatest accomplishment to date “is raising her beautiful daughter to love the Lord and to get a good education that allows her to be independently successful.” Lynn is a member of Wheat Swamp Christian Church where she teaches Sunday school and is a Youth Leader. During her time working with the youth at church, she received the Mentor Pin from Brian Hardy during his Eagle Scout Ceremony. Lynn very much enjoys serving in her church and community.
Lynn reflects, “I absolutely love my job and the fact that I am supported professionally and personally by Mitchell Family Dentistry. Every day I work with a dental team whose main objective is to provide the best oral care possible to the patients we serve.” We are grateful to work alongside someone with that mindset.
